cleanGallery Stack
cleanGallery Stack Settings*
- # of Images: use the slider to select the number of images that will be included in your slideshow. The Stacks add-on will create the necessary "buckets" for you to drop cleanGallery Image Stacks into them
- Background: set the color for the background of the slideshow itself
- Frame Color: set the color of the frame
- Frame W (px): set the width of the frame, ranging from 0px (no border) to 25px
- Frame Radius: set the radius of the rounded corners, ranging from 0px (square corners) to 10px
- Drop Shadow: to show or hide the drop shadow effect
- Auto Start: check to start the slideshow automatically after loading
- Random First Image: check to start the slideshow at a random image. In unchecked, the slideshow will start from the first image
- Navigation on Right: show the navigation on right or left
- Hide Controls: check to hide the control icons
- Hide Thumbnails: check to hide the thumbnails
- Hide Description: check to hide the description
- Description Bg: set the color of the background of the description area
- Description Text: set the color of the text in the description area
- Duration (sec): set the duration in seconds for each image
- Speed (msec): set the speed of the transition between images (in milliseconds)
*If the info box (HUD) is too long for your screen size, follow these 3 steps:
- Drag the RW project window down
- Drag the info box (HUD) up, past the top of the RW project window
- Drag the RW project window back up
cleanGallery Image Stack Settings
- Include one stack for each image in the slideshow
- Thumbnail: provide the path to the thumbnail image. Images can be located in the Page Assets (RapidWeaver 4), Resources (RapidWeaver 5) or on a server
- Full Size Image: provide the path to the full size image. Just as with the thumbnails, images can be located in the Page Assets (RapidWeaver 4), Resources (RapidWeaver 5), or on a server
- Description: enter the optional text to be displayed in the description area
- Alt Tag: enter the optional text to be used as an Alt Tag (important for SEO purposes)
